Tiger Woods Envisions Transformative Changes for Professional Golf

In the latest press conference held during the Hero World Challenge, golf legend Tiger Woods has stirred excitement and speculation by hinting at significant transformations on the horizon for professional golf. Known for his candidness and visionary thinking, Woods addressed the future of the PGA Tour and shared thoughts that could reshape the landscape of the sport as we know it.

Woods’s remarks have sparked conversations among fans, players, and analysts, emphasizing the need for evolution within professional golf. In recent years, the sport has witnessed shifts in player dynamics, fan engagement, and technological advancements, all of which set the stage for potential restructuring. Golf enthusiasts are eager to understand what these changes could entail, particularly coming from someone with Woods’s extensive expertise and influence.

One critical aspect Woods touched upon is the necessity for the PGA Tour to adapt to contemporary challenges. In an era where sports consumption is heavily impacted by digital platforms and social media, Woods advocates for a more engaging experience for fans. Enhancing the connection between players and their audience is paramount to sustain interest, particularly among younger demographics who may be seeking more than just traditional viewing experiences.

Transparency and accessibility have also emerged as focal points for Woods. The sport’s growing popularity has prompted calls for greater inclusivity, allowing more fans to experience top-notch events firsthand. Woods mentioned exploring options to increase ticket accessibility and consider fan-friendly initiatives that could expand the reach of live tournaments. By aligning the game’s image with a younger audience, the PGA Tour could strengthen its fanbase and ensure longevity in a competitive entertainment landscape.

Technology plays a crucial role in the evolution of sports, and Woods believes that embracing innovative tools could redefine how professional golf is played and consumed. From enhanced broadcasting techniques to the integration of real-time statistics, the possibilities are broad. Circling back to his personal experiences, Woods emphasized the importance of harnessing technology to elevate the viewing experience while keeping traditional values intact.

Moreover, Woods hinted at a potential overhaul of the tournament structure. Many players have echoed similar thoughts—suggesting changes to the format of events, prize distributions, and overall competition structures. Such adjustments could lead to increased competitiveness and excitement during tournaments, ultimately benefiting both players and fans alike. The idea of adaptive competition formats may appeal to golf purists while inviting new fans to engage more deeply with the sport.

Woods’s insights also delve into the mentorship opportunities for young players striving to make a mark in professional golf. By creating platforms and programs that foster development, the experienced players can pass down their knowledge, enriching the next generation. This mentorship dynamic could help bridge the gap between seasoned professionals and aspiring golfers, ensuring a vibrant future for the sport.

Returning to the subject of inclusivity, Woods highlighted the importance of engaging diverse communities in golf. By promoting participation at grassroots levels and making resources available to a wider audience, the sport can cultivate talent from various backgrounds. Emphasizing this approach is paramount not only for the growth of golf but also for reflecting the diverse society we live in today.

The dialogue initiated by Woods could elevate conversations surrounding women’s golf as well. The potential changes could open doors for greater visibility of female athletes while promoting gender equality within the sport. Woods’s commitment to inclusivity could significantly impact how women participate and are represented in professional golf, thereby fostering a more diverse and appealing environment for future generations.

In conclusion, Tiger Woods’s recent press conference at the Hero World Challenge has revealed an ambitious vision for the future of professional golf. His thoughts on innovative changes, inclusivity, mentorship, and technological integration offer promising avenues for the PGA Tour. As the sport stands at a crossroads, it is clear that adapting to modern challenges will be vital in keeping golf relevant, exciting, and accessible for years to come.

Woods’s influence and leadership will undoubtedly play a crucial role in steering this transformation. Golf fans, players, and industry stakeholders will need to stay tuned as these developments unfold. The future looks bright for professional golf, with Woods at the helm championing the necessary changes for a more dynamic, engaging, and inclusive experience for all.
